Apple tree

There are many different kinds of apple trees, and all of them have beautiful flowers. After three or five years, trees often start to bear fruit.

+ + +

Chaste tree

Lavender flowers grow on the chaste tree. This tree needs to be pruned regularly, and it grows best in soil that drains well.

+ + +

Flowering almond

Almond trees that bloom have pink or white flowers. This plant does best in a soil that is wet, rich, and acidic. It can grow in both full sun and some shade.

+ + +

Crape myrtle

Kousa dogwood

A Kousa dogwood can grow well in many different situations. The flowers can be white or pink in the spring, and the red fruits show up in the fall.

+ + +

Franklin tree

The white flowers on this tree are big and smell good. They grow best in acidic soil that is moist and well-drained.

+ + +

Chinese fringetree

This tree has flowers that are white and smell good. It does well in either full sun or light shade, as long as the soil is moist and drains well.

+ + +

Green hawthorn

In the spring, the tree has white blooms, and in the fall, it has red berries. Even though it is called a "thorn tree," this tree has no thorns.
